How to Find Someone in Moline Police Department
If you suspect that a friend or family member is at the Moline city Jail, you can confirm by calling the Moline police department at 309-797-0401. Likewise, most inmates sentenced to more than one year in Moline city Jail will serve their sentences at the Rock Island County County Jail or nearby Illinois state prison. Hence, you can use the Rock Island County County Jail online inmate lookup to confirm their whereabouts.

Send a Mail/Package
Inmates can send and receive mails and packages while at the Moline city Jail. Still, this correspondence must pass through a Moline Police Department detention officer for checking and approval.
Sending Money
You can deposit cash in person at the Moline Police Department’s self-service kiosks. Second, the Moline Police Department has an online deposit option whereby you have to register and top up an inmate’s commissary account. Indicate the inmate’s full names and inmate Illinois ID at the back of the money order. Call the Moline city Police Department administration at 309-797-0401 for further clarification.
Phone Calls
Inmates at Moline city Jail can make free telephone calls to their friends and family members as they go through the booking process at Moline Police Department. Afterward, they have to provide to Moline Police Department a list of persons they want to call for approval. It is a 22 minutes call that reduces to 7 minutes during rush hours.
Visitation Rules
Inmates at the Moline city Jail can have 3 visits from not more than 4 visitors per day. These are 16-minutes visiting sessions from 1 pm to 4 pm each day. Still, the inmate at the Moline Police Department can get a visit from an attorney, bondsman, or clergy at any time. Call the Moline Police Department at 309-797-0401 to arrange for the visit.
